AOChat: Not expecting login&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
This error occurs after authentication has failed. This is most commonly caused by changes made in recent PHP versions causing the key generation of the AOChat library to fail. The most common workaround is to install Auno&amp;#039;s AOKex PHP extention which will then be used to generate the login key needed. Be aware however that AOKex is not without it&amp;#039;s issues either. It must be compiled against either the GMP library or the OpenSSL library and in addition the library must be correctly installed. Ie, on most RPM based Linux distros you can install gmp-devel which in itself will be enough for AOKex to compile, but will cause errors when PHP attempts to load AOKex since the actual GMP library will be missing.&lt;/div&gt;</summary>
